What utilities do you need to live off grid in a cabin?
The essential utilities for off grid cabin living include power generation, water supply, and waste management systems. These utilities must operate independently from public infrastructure to maintain self-sufficiency.
Power can come from solar panels, wind turbines, or generators. Water is typically sourced from wells, rainwater collection, or nearby natural bodies. Waste management involves septic tanks, composting toilets, or other onsite treatment methods. Properly designing and maintaining these utilities ensures a functional and sustainable off grid cabin.
Which power sources are viable for off grid cabins?
Viable power sources for off grid cabins include solar panels, wind turbines, micro-hydro systems, and backup generators. Solar power is the most common due to its scalability and decreasing costs. Wind turbines work well in consistently windy areas but require more maintenance. Micro-hydro systems harness flowing water but depend on suitable water sources. Backup generators provide reliability during low renewable energy production but require fuel and maintenance.
How is water supply typically managed off grid?
Water supply off grid is managed through wells, rainwater harvesting, springs, or nearby streams and lakes. Wells provide a reliable source if groundwater is accessible. Rainwater collection systems use gutters and storage tanks to capture precipitation. Springs and surface water require filtration and treatment for safety. Water management also includes conservation practices to ensure sustainable use.
What waste management systems work best in cabins?
Effective waste management systems for cabins include septic tanks, composting toilets, and graywater recycling. Septic tanks treat sewage onsite but require proper soil conditions and maintenance. Composting toilets convert human waste into compost without water, ideal for remote locations. Graywater systems recycle water from sinks and showers for irrigation. Choosing the right system depends on local regulations, site conditions, and personal preferences.

How does solar power support off grid cabin living?
Solar power supports off grid cabin living by providing a renewable, low-maintenance source of electricity. Solar panels convert sunlight into electrical energy stored in batteries for use when the sun isn’t shining. This system powers lighting, appliances, and communication devices without relying on fuel or grid connections. Solar setups can be scaled to meet varying energy needs and paired with generators for backup. Proper sizing and maintenance maximize efficiency and system lifespan.
Are there alternative energy options besides solar?
Alternative energy options besides solar for off grid cabins include wind turbines, micro-hydro generators, and propane or diesel generators. Wind turbines work well in consistently windy areas but require more complex installation and maintenance. Micro-hydro systems generate power from flowing water but need a reliable water source with sufficient flow and drop. Propane and diesel generators provide reliable backup power but depend on fuel availability and produce emissions. Combining multiple energy sources can enhance reliability and reduce environmental impact.

How do you select suitable land for an off grid cabin?
Selecting suitable land for an off grid cabin requires assessing water availability, solar exposure, soil quality, and legal zoning. Access to a reliable water source is critical for drinking, irrigation, and sanitation. Solar exposure affects the efficiency of solar power systems. Soil quality impacts septic system feasibility and gardening potential. Additionally, check local zoning laws and land ownership to ensure off grid living is permitted and sustainable.
What are the key steps in building the cabin itself?
Key steps in building an off grid cabin include site preparation, foundation installation, framing, roofing, and interior finishing. Start by clearing and leveling the land while preserving natural features. Construct a durable foundation suited to the soil and climate. Build the frame using sustainable materials and design for energy efficiency. Install roofing that protects against weather and supports solar panels if planned. Finish interiors with insulation, windows, and fixtures that enhance comfort and functionality.
How do you install and maintain utilities off grid?
Installing utilities off grid involves setting up power generation, water systems, and waste management tailored to the site and lifestyle. Solar panels or alternative energy sources must be mounted, wired, and connected to battery storage. Water systems like wells or rainwater tanks require pumps, filters, and plumbing. Waste systems such as septic tanks or composting toilets need proper installation and ventilation. Regular maintenance includes cleaning filters, checking batteries, inspecting plumbing, and managing waste to ensure reliable operation.

What environmental factors pose risks to off grid cabins?
Environmental factors posing risks to off grid cabins include extreme weather, wildfires, flooding, and wildlife encounters. Severe storms can damage structures and power systems. Wildfires threaten remote wooded areas, requiring defensible space and fire-resistant materials. Flooding can contaminate water supplies and damage foundations. Wildlife may cause property damage or safety concerns. Designing cabins with these risks in mind and preparing emergency plans enhances resilience.

How do you optimize cabin design for comfort?
Optimizing cabin design for comfort includes proper insulation, strategic window placement, and efficient heating and cooling systems. Insulation reduces heat loss in winter and heat gain in summer, lowering energy needs. South-facing windows maximize natural light and warmth. Ventilation prevents moisture buildup and improves air quality. Incorporating thermal mass materials helps stabilize indoor temperatures. Thoughtful layout and durable materials also contribute to comfort and longevity.
What lifestyle adjustments improve off grid living?
Lifestyle adjustments that improve off grid living include conserving energy, planning meals around available resources, and scheduling maintenance tasks. Reducing electricity use during low production periods prevents outages. Growing or preserving food reduces dependency on stores. Establishing routines for water collection, system checks, and waste management maintains functionality. Embracing simplicity and flexibility helps adapt to the unique challenges of off grid life.
How can you maintain connectivity and communication?
Maintaining connectivity and communication off grid can be achieved through satellite internet, cellular boosters, and two-way radios. Satellite internet provides access in remote locations without traditional infrastructure. Cellular boosters enhance weak signals for calls and data. Two-way radios offer reliable short-range communication for emergencies or daily coordination. Backup power ensures devices remain operational during outages. Staying connected supports safety and social interaction.

What routine maintenance is required for solar power systems?
Routine maintenance for solar power systems includes cleaning panels to remove dirt and debris, checking battery charge levels, and inspecting wiring for damage. Dust and bird droppings can reduce panel efficiency, so regular cleaning is necessary. Batteries should be monitored for voltage and electrolyte levels if applicable. Wiring and connections must be secure and free from corrosion. Periodic professional inspections help identify issues early and maintain optimal performance.
How do you keep water supply systems functional?
Keeping water supply systems functional involves regular testing for contaminants, cleaning filters, and maintaining pumps and storage tanks. Water quality testing ensures safety for drinking and household use. Filters need replacement or cleaning to prevent clogging and maintain flow. Pumps require lubrication and inspection to avoid breakdowns. Storage tanks should be sealed and cleaned to prevent algae growth and contamination.
What are best practices for waste management upkeep?
Best practices for waste management upkeep include regular inspection of septic tanks or composting toilets, proper waste disposal, and system ventilation. Septic tanks need periodic pumping to prevent overflow. Composting toilets require monitoring moisture and temperature to facilitate decomposition. Avoid flushing harmful chemicals or non-biodegradable materials. Ventilation prevents odors and promotes aerobic breakdown. Keeping waste systems well-maintained protects health and the environment.

Can you live off grid year-round in a cabin?
Yes, you can live off grid year-round in a cabin if it is properly designed and equipped for seasonal changes. This includes adequate insulation, heating systems, reliable power, and water supply that function in winter and summer. Planning for snow load, freezing temperatures, and shorter daylight hours is essential. Backup power and water storage help manage extreme conditions. Many successfully maintain year-round off grid lifestyles with proper preparation.
